我刚刚通过MSDN
订阅下载并安装了Visual Studio 2015 Enterprise和Update 2 .我看到Build中的消息表明Xamarin
Visual Studio Enterprise现在已免费,但我收到以下许可错误:
Run Code Online (Sandbox Code Playgroud)1>------ Build started: Project: App1.Droid, Configuration: Debug Any CPU ----- 1>C:\Users\Parrot\Projects\App1\App1\App1.Droid\Properties\AndroidManifest.xml : warning XA0101: @(Content) build action is not supported 1> App1.Droid -> C:\Users\Parrot\Projects\App1\App1\App1.Droid\bin\Debug\App1.Droid.dll 1>C:\Program Files (x86)\MSBuild\Xamarin\Android\Xamarin.Android.Common.targets(379,5): mandroid error XA9005: User code size, 2945919 bytes, is larger than 131072 and requires aáBusinessá(or higher) License. 1>C:\Program Files (x86)\MSBuild\Xamarin\Android\Xamarin.Android.Common.targets(379,5): mandroid error XA9006: Using type `Android.Runtime.JNIEnv` requiresáBusinessá(or higher) License. ========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========== ========== …
我已经建立了一个新的 Xamarin.Forms项目.我想构建它并将其部署到模拟器或Android设备,但它无法正常工作.在Visual Studio的Outputwindow中,显示以下错误:
该应用程序无法启动.确保已将应用程序安装到目标设备并具有可启动活动(MainLauncher = true).
更新:
如果我查看构建日志,我可以找到以下内容:
2> Mono.AndroidTools.InstallFailedException:意外的安装输出:错误:无法访问包管理器.系统在运行吗?
2> bei Mono.AndroidTools.Internal.AdbOutputParsing.CheckInstallSuccess(String output,String packageName)
2> bei Mono.AndroidTools.AndroidDevice.c__AnonStoreyD.<> m__0(任务`1 t)
2> bei System.Threading.Tasks.ContinuationTaskFromResultTask`1.InnerInvoke()
2> bei System.Threading.Tasks.Task.Execute()
2>部署因内部错误而失败:意外安装输出:错误:无法访问程序包管理器.系统在运行吗?
我正在将我的代码从 Xamarin Studio (Mac) 移动到 Visual Studio。我可以从 Xamarin Studio 在 Xcode 中打开故事板文件。如果我在 Xcode 中进行更改,关闭它,然后在 Xamarin Studio 中打开,我的所有更改都会成功导入,包括 IBAction 和 IBOutlets。当我在 Visual Studio 中尝试同样的事情时,我看不到创建 IBOutlet 和 IBAction 的视图控制器文件。这在 Visual Studio 中不支持还是我遗漏了什么?
visual-studio xamarin.ios xamarin xamarin-studio visual-studio-2015